Output 21ea784990f4cb648a9a7dfe169ac22ad615da5baa3e1d7826e58aa286e79fd9:1

value
123147989
script pubkey
OP_0 OP_PUSHBYTES_32 3cc1ff888fd8335a52053d93889b1e5933bb937af8c606923897ae9d36a4af5f
address
bc1q8nqllzy0mqe455s98kfc3xc7tyemhym6lrrqdy3cj7hf6d4y4a0syugqgt
transaction
21ea784990f4cb648a9a7dfe169ac22ad615da5baa3e1d7826e58aa286e79fd9